Description Andrej Nemec 2017-05-10 08:41:31 UTC
The archive_read_format_cab_read_header function in archive_read_support_format_cab.c in libarchive 3.2.2 allows attackers to cause a denial of service (heap-based buffer over-read and application crash) via a crafted file.
